Safety Features

Kreg Track Sawhas a blade guard. This keeps the blade covered. It helps prevent accidents. The saw also has a riving knife. This stops the wood from pinching the blade. It reduces kickback.

Makitaprovides a similar guard. It also has an electric brake. This stops the blade quickly. Less time spinning means more safety. Both saws have safety switches. You need to press them before cutting.

Will Festool Track Saw Work On Kreg Track?

Festool track saws do not fit Kreg tracks. Each brand designs tracks specifically for their tools. Compatibility issues arise due to differing widths and grooves. Always check dimensions before purchasing tracks or saws. Consider investing in matching brand components for seamless operation and optimal performance.
